About Kraft Heinz Co

In July 2015, Kraft merged with Heinz to create the third-largest food and beverage manufacturer in North America behind PepsiCo and Nestle and the fifth-largest player in the world. Beyond its namesake brands, the combined firm's portfolio includes Oscar Mayer, Velveeta, and Philadelphia. Outside North America, the firm's global reach includes a distribution network in Europe and emerging markets that drive around one fifth of its consolidated sales base, as its products are sold in more than 190 countries and territories.

About OneSpan Inc

OneSpan Inc. is a global leader in providing digital agreement security solutions. The company's platform helps organizations, primarily in the financial services sector, to secure their digital agreements and transactions, including e-signatures, multi-factor authentication, and transaction monitoring. OneSpan's technology is focused on protecting customers from fraud and meeting regulatory compliance requirements in a digital-first environment.
